Transaction 21a8b5e01dd29772a2112083bfb11416797a94073393117e4e438de3097c88ac
1 Input
1 Output
-
21a8b5e01dd29772a2112083bfb11416797a94073393117e4e438de3097c88ac:0
- value
- 57014
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 726d12f5b5c77899878689904ea8020dff4dfcde50161ec517d7e4de8dc89f5c
- address
- bc1pwfk39ad4caufnpux3xgya2qzphl5mlx72qtpa3gh6ljdarwgnawqlrf889